การอ้างอิงคลาส GMSNavigationSpeedAlertOptions

การอ้างอิงคลาส GMSNavigationSpeedAlertOptions

ภาพรวม

คลาสที่เปลี่ยนแปลงไม่ได้ซึ่งกำหนดเกณฑ์การทริกเกอร์สำหรับความรุนแรงของการแจ้งเตือนความเร็วระดับต่างๆ ซึ่งแสดงโดย GMSNavigationSpeedAlertSeverity

คุณสามารถใช้เกณฑ์นี้เพื่อปรับแต่งเกณฑ์การทริกเกอร์การแจ้งเตือนความเร็วเป็นเปอร์เซ็นต์สำหรับการแจ้งเตือนทั้งระดับเล็กและใหญ่ และปรับแต่งเกณฑ์การทริกเกอร์ตามเวลาสำหรับการแจ้งเตือนความเร็วหลักได้

การแจ้งเตือนความเร็วที่ทริกเกอร์โดยเกณฑ์ที่เกี่ยวข้องจาก GMSNavigationSpeedAlertOptions นี้จะมี UI ที่กําหนดเองใน GMSNavigationSpeedometerUIOptions หากมีการตั้งค่า

รับค่าโดย GMSNavigationMutableSpeedAlertOptions

ฟังก์ชันสมาชิกแบบสาธารณะ

(CGFloat)- thresholdPercentageForSpeedAlertSeverity:
 รับเกณฑ์การแจ้งเตือนความเร็ว (เป็นเปอร์เซ็นต์) สำหรับ GMSNavigationSpeedAlertSeverity ที่เฉพาะเจาะจง

พร็อพเพอร์ตี้

NSTimeIntervalseverityUpgradeDurationSeconds
 เกณฑ์ระยะเวลาจะควบคุมการอัปเกรดความรุนแรงของการแจ้งเตือนความเร็ว

เอกสารประกอบเกี่ยวกับฟังก์ชันสมาชิก

รับเกณฑ์การแจ้งเตือนความเร็ว (เป็นเปอร์เซ็นต์) สำหรับ GMSNavigationSpeedAlertSeverity ที่เฉพาะเจาะจง

ค่า 0.0 หมายถึง 0% และ 1.0 หมายถึง 100% ค่าลบหมายความว่าไม่มีการตั้งค่าเกณฑ์สำหรับ SpeedingType ดังกล่าว


เอกสารประกอบเกี่ยวกับอสังหาริมทรัพย์

- (NSTimeInterval) severityUpgradeDurationSeconds [read, assign]

เกณฑ์ระยะเวลาจะควบคุมการอัปเกรดความรุนแรงของการแจ้งเตือนความเร็ว

การแจ้งเตือนความเร็วหลักจะทำงานเมื่อความเร็วเกินเกณฑ์การแจ้งเตือนความเร็วเล็กน้อยเกินกว่าจำนวนวินาทีที่ระบุ

ซึ่งนำมาใช้ใน GMSNavigationMutableSpeedAlertOptions